S02E287 Girls, Part 9, Pirates Ahoy!

The first batch of kids walk in with their parents and I notice that the kids are all wearing pirate costumes. 

“Oh, right,” Charlie says, and suddenly he’s in pirate costume as well. 

“Charlie,” Joy grabs his hand and whispers. “You know pirates?!”

Charlie’s confused for a second. Then he says, “It’s a theme party, Joy. I asked my mom to have my birthday be about pirates.” He motions to her clothes. “You’re already dressed for the party!” 

More kids come in, boys and girls, and fill the small living room. Overall, there are about twelve kids. 

Some of them point at Joy and gesture to the others to look.

“Who’s this?” says one of the girls. 

Joy takes a step back and stands behind Charlie. 

“This is Joy!” Charlie says proudly. “She’s my best friend!” 

Two of the boys gasp. 

“You mean she’s real!” one of them says in awe.

“Super real!” Charlie says as Joy withers under the stares. 

“All the adventures you keep talking about are real?!” one of the girls says.

“Totally real!” Charlie says.

A girl gets really close to Joy, her eyes near Joy’s cheeks. “You really fought zombies?” 

“Uh-huh,” Charlie says. Joy nods, strangely mute.

“And you fought monsters and evil pirates?” 

“Uh-huh,” Charlie says. 

“Prove it!” one of the boys points at Joy.

Joy looks around, not knowing what to do. 

“Where’s your dragon?” the boy says.

“She’s not here,” Joy says weakly. “I don’t know where she is.” 

“Where are all the zombies?” another boy says.

“Where are the monsters?” the first boy says. 

“Boys, boys,” Suzy tries to step in. 

Suddenly Joy steps forward. “I can give you a killer robot!” she says proudly. 

The kids freeze in place. Joy points at Master Mind. 

“This is Master Mind, he used to be an evil killer robot and now he’s a good guy! Master Mind, show them your weapons!” 

Master Mind extends a hand and a rocket comes out of his arm’s exoskeleton.

The kids gasp. “No way!” “OMG!” 

“Master Mind!” Justin comes in from the kitchen, carrying a tray of food. “No weapons! This is a birthday party!” 

The rocket drops back into the inside of his exoskeleton. 

“She’s a real pirate!” “She’s a pirate!” the kids tell each other. “Everything Charlie said was true!” “She’s real!” “Rob should have been here!” 

And suddenly everyone wants to talk to Joy. Joy pulls out her sword and lets the kids touch it.

(To be continued…)
